Docker:docker部署Redis5.0服务

docker镜像库拉取镜像

# 下载镜像
docker pull redis:4.0

查看镜像

# 查看下载镜像
docker images 

启动镜像

# 启动镜像
  docker run --name my-redis -p 63791:6379 -v /home/redis/data:/data -v /home/redis/conf:/usr/local/etc/redis/redis.conf --restart always -d redis:4.0 redis-server --appendonly yes

命令说明:

--name my-redis                                 启动后容器名为 my-redis

-p  63791:6379                                   将容器的 6379 端口映射到宿主机的 63791 端口

-v  /usr/local/workspace/redis/data:/data                      将容器    /usr/local/workspace/redis/data  日志目录挂载到宿主机的 /data

-v  /home/redis/conf:/usr/local/etc/redis/redis.conf       将容器    /usr/local/etc/redis/redis.conf 配置目录挂载到宿主机的 /conf

redis-server --appendonly yes                        在容器执行redis-server启动命令,并打开redis持久化配置

redis-server --requirepass 123456                            配置redis的登录密码

 进入redis容器查看数据的方式

// 进入容器的同时登录redis
docker exec -it myredis redis-cli

 redis常用简单命令

//  获取所有的key
keys *

// 选择第一个库
select 0 

//清除指定库
flush db      

提示:Redis 配置文件可以从 Redis 的 GitHub 仓库中找到。

 

文章转载至:https://www.cnblogs.com/haoprogrammer/p/11018312.html

posted @ 2020-08-03 16:40  怒吼的萝卜  阅读(683)  评论(0编辑  收藏  举报